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H8441
Hebrew: תּוֹעֵבַה
Transliteration: tôwʻêbah
Pronunciation: to-ay-baw'
Part of Speech: Noun Feminine
Bible Usage: abominable ({custom} {thing}) abomination.
Definition:
properly something disgusting ({morally}) that {is} (as noun) an abhorrence; especially idolatry or (concretely) an idol
1. a disgusting thing, abomination, abominable
a. in ritual sense (of unclean food, idols, mixed marriages)
b. in ethical sense (of wickedness etc)
